Curly hair is dry hair and every inch of every strand on your beautiful head needs to quench that moisture. Wet your curly hair first, then add a huge dollop of your deep conditioner to it, making sure that no strand is left uncovered.
We’ve tried and tested many deep conditioning routines and have found out that the secret to a successful deep conditioning treatment is indirect heat. So the next time you deep condition your curls, wrap it in a towel and step into a steaming bathtub. Not only will you get a nice relaxing bath session, but the steam from the water will also allow the conditioner to seep into your curls and work its magic. If you don’t have a bathtub to jump into, simply cover your curly hair with a shower cap and blow dry it on the lowest settings. It may seem a little weird but trust us, this works!
When rinsing out your deep conditioner, we always recommend using cold water. The cold water helps close the cuticles of the hair and effectively works towards retaining the moisture in the strands.
